		<description>From my Blog:

It insults my common sense and intelligence when one of our MPs say that live TV coverage doesn&#039;t allow NA members to concentrate or contribute to the discussion of bills. Such absurdity must be false and it is worse than giving no reasons at all. This reminds me of a Lincoln&#039;s quote - &quot;&quot;Better to remain silent and be thought a fool than to speak out and remove all doubt.&quot;

But if it is true - it seriously brings into question the capabilities of our MPs, and with or without TV, their contributions may not matter. I have always thought our MPs to be fairly well-informed and intelligent.

With very little common sense, one can see the benefits of live coverage -

    * The people would be able to follow and understand the discussions on some of the bills.
    * This is an opportunity to see their elected representatives contribute to the nation through debates and discussions - an integral process in any democracy
    * Finally - also an opportunity for the MPs to demonstrate to their constituents that their trust and confidence aren&#039;t misplaced.

Whatever, such episodes embarrass me and also diminish the respect that I have for our elected representatives.</description>
